The South Carolina Department of Administration Division of Enterprise Applications is seeking an experienced Program Manager to provide hands-on leadership and structure to a large complex project transitioning from a large State agencys legacy financial system to the States ERP system (SCEIS). This project is currently being rebaselined and the contractor will play a critical role in guiding it through implementing disciplined program management and collaborative stakeholder engagement.

The Program Manager will support the state agencys technology interests ensuring successful execution greater accountability and strong alignment with project goals. The contractor will work closely within the PMO team and partner with an external agency that owns the business process and vendor relationship.
